Many women don’t want to lift weights. They actually think that workout routines for women consist of only cardio! I hear this all the time. “I’m strong”. “I don’t want to be bulky.” “I don’t need to lift weights.” Well, there are so many GREAT benefits to lifting weights for women, including staving off osteoporosis. If you don’t believe me, ask your doctor!
And don’t worry, you are NOT going to get bulky. The only way you can have huge bulky muscles is if you work at it really, really hard. You would have to eat thousands of calories a day and somehow boost your testosterone levels through supplements.
Lifting weights create’s a sleek, toned, beautiful body! So, get in there ladies, and start pumping iron!

Many women have a common place that they gain body fat. Some call it the muffin top, others call it the spare tire. Either way, it is a very common place that we all want to get rid of. Core workout routines are very important to target the larger muscle groups and get rid of weight over all. Weight lifting should always be included in workout routines for women! People think they can come in and just do abdominal exercises and you will get rid of your middle section, but the body does not lose weight like that. We lose weight overall. So, doing any sort or muscle building overall would be the most beneficial.
